Output e2358511b526f93cb186051b1a322daa5092e65fade7dd2795c039119eca515a:0

value
252763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d606bd2b6b706e16508f84caea1e38dd0deaf8b OP_EQUALVERIFY OP_CHECKSIG
address
1848YEUJmFzNCsjDZjwnzyuih85YPFKGy4
transaction
e2358511b526f93cb186051b1a322daa5092e65fade7dd2795c039119eca515a
spent
true